Morocco Train Pass Options

Learn whether Morocco offers rail passes and how to save on tickets.

Are rail passes available?

Morocco does not have a widely used tourist rail pass like some European networks. Most travelers buy point-to-point tickets.

How to save on tickets

Book early for long-distance routes and compare 1st vs 2nd class fares. Promotions can appear during off-peak periods.

Who benefits from a pass?

If you plan multiple long journeys in a short time, compare total point-to-point fares before searching for pass options.

FAQs

Is there an ONCF tourist pass?

Not commonly. Most travelers buy individual tickets.

Are discounts available for frequent travel?

Occasional promotions exist. Check the booking system for current deals.

Can I buy a pass at the station?

Ask at major stations if any seasonal offers apply.
